The Land of Little Rain

Focusing on the American Southwest, this collection of essays explores the intricate relationship between nature and humanity. Through interconnected narratives linked by waterways, the author examines the lives of local animals, the growth of flora, and the changing seasons. The lyrical portrayal of the desert and lowlands highlights the beauty of the region while presenting humans as intruders in a delicate ecosystem. Themes of nature's supremacy versus human impact weave throughout, offering a reflective perspective on the environment.
